No, you do not need to send a copy of your state tax return with your federal tax return. State tax returns are filed separately from federal tax returns and typically do not need to be submitted together.
It depends on the state (we don't know what state you are in) and the complexity of your return. Some states require a copy of your federal return. Some states require a copy only if you have certain types of income or file certain forms. Some states do not require a copy at all. Check the instruction booklet that came with your state tax forms. It should tell you what you need to send. If you are filing your state return electronically you do not need to mail in a copy of your federal return.
